The measured results
Every number below is read straight from the test. Products are listed in the order they finished.
Tooth Design
- 1Milwaukee Axe5 tooth
per inch (TPI) design; described as having the most aggressive tooth offset design of the three
- 2Diablo5 teeth
per inch at the base and 5 teeth per inch through the main part of the blade; less tooth offset than the Milwaukee Axe. Meta chapter title lists '7 TPI at the base' for this segment, which conflicts with the narrated 5 TPI figure; kept both, flagged as unresolved.
- 3Lenox6
TPI, described as the most conservative design of the three with a narrower blade offset
Nail And 2 X 4 Test
- 1Milwaukee Axe
most aggressive design, shredded the 2x4 as well as the nails
- 2Diablo
cut through the board in only 6 seconds without shredding the 2x4 nearly as much as the Milwaukee
- 3Lenox
came in last place; narrator was surprised given its less aggressive TPI; more blade pinch than Diablo or Milwaukee
Hardwood Test
- 1Milwaukee Axe
took second place behind Diablo in the reversed-order fence post test; blade got gummed up with gooey melted paint residue from the old fence post, which the narrator says likely cost it the win: 'I think that Milwaukee would have won this competition had it not been for the paint'
- 2Diablo
took the lead in the reversed-order fence post test; blade stayed smooth and free of the gooey paint buildup that slowed the other two blades
- 3Lenox
finished third in the reversed-order fence post test, 'as expected because of the tooth design'; blade also got gummed up with gooey melted paint residue
Drywall Screw Test
- 1Milwaukee Axe
worst damage of the three, five different teeth had significant damage
- 2Diablo
two teeth had damage, described as a more aggressive blade design than the Lenox
- 3Lenox
the conservative blade design 'came in very handy' and prevented significant damage from the drywall screws; best of the three. Carbide Condition
- 1Milwaukee Axe
carbide teeth still in good condition despite heat-blackened steel
- 2Diablo
carbide teeth still in good condition despite heat-blackened steel
- 3Lenox
carbide teeth still in good condition despite heat-blackened steel
How it was tested
- nail and pressure-treated 2x4 cutting test (3/16 finishing nails and 16-penny nails, 20 lb load jig, 12 amp Sawzall with 1 1/8 in stroke)
- hardwood fence post cutting test (50 to 60 year old hedge apple / Osage Orange post, each blade cut twice in reversed order, scores averaged due to inconsistent wood quality and old paint buildup)
- drywall screw damage test (2x4 with 3 drywall screws embedded)
